Guarding Against Skin Cancer In Dogs

Skin cancer is absolutely not only a worry for humans. Animals can acquire it as well. Many of us know that ultraviolet radiation is very harmful and it is a major cause of skin cancer in dogs. Simply no dog owner would like to see their faithful pal contend with this sort of cancer and the very good news is that this might be successfully prevented in a lot of situations. It is usually mistakenly assumed that due to the fact animals have fur, they are not as sensitive to the results of direct exposure to UV radiation. Nonetheless, steps might be taken to defend your dog from UV rays.

Skin cancer ranks as the second most frequent cancer in felines even while it is the first most widespread cancer in pet dogs. It has been calculated that 450 dogs from each 100,000 are clinically diagnosed with this affliction. In cats, it has been calculated that 120 of every 100,000 are diagnosed as having the affliction.

It's commonly thought that a pet's fur coat defends them from acquiring skin cancer. Nevertheless, this is generally wrong. The threat of developing this particular cancer is in addition based on the breed of the pet. Several breeds feature thinner coats plus they possess light colored skin on the ears and stomachs. These spots are the most prone to cancer development. Skin cancer in dogs is as a result not as uncommon as folks may perhaps think.

Too much exposure to sunlight is not totally the only causative factor. Skin cancer in dogs could be attributed to viruses and hormones, vaccinations, genetics as well as burns. Dog owners who have educated themselves regarding the problems of acquiring this variety of cancer are much more likely to make sure that their animals are safeguarded and hence, these pets are at a diminished threat of acquiring the disease.

It's recommended that an SPF 30 sun screen is placed on uncovered spots of skin on both cats and dogs. Sun screen really should generally be applied routinely to any bare spots or any places where the skin is hardly protected. This may include the stomach and the ears. Moreover, it can be wise to keep your dog indoors, out of the sun, during the hours of 10 am and 4 pm. This really is when the rays are generally at their strongest.

Clothing your pet is one more method to defend your animal from developing skin cancer. Any time skin is covered up, it's shielded. This goes for people also. When you would like to spend time outdoors together with your family pet, you may perhaps wish to clothe your canine in a t-shirt or hat, if they're happy to put on these items. Although your dog may possibly not enjoy wearing clothing, it is going to be guarded from damaging ultraviolet rays.
